WINDEA Offshore acquires share in Heinemann Projektberatung

WINDEA HPB

HAMBURG – WINDEA Offshore GmbH & Co. KG from Hamburg has become a minority shareholder in Heinemann Projektberatung GmbH, based in Wilhelmshaven and Elsfleth, since the beginning of March. Both companies see various synergies in the areas of industry training and materials management through closer cooperation and benefit from each other’s know-how as well as customer network. Due to the same industry environment, both partners have great potential for new customer access and innovative business developments. The founder and CEO of Heinemann Projektberatung GmbH, Holger Heinemann, remains the majority shareholder and will continue to manage the operational business of the company.

WINDEA Offshore has been offering a wide range of services and holistic logistics solutions for the offshore wind industry since 2011. This includes the provision of service technicians and other personnel who are deployed along the offshore wind value chain and need to be trained accordingly. So far, the training of these personnel, e.g. according to GWO standards, has not been part of the company’s own portfolio. “The need for industry training prescribed by authorities and by customers, both based on fixed standards and to customer-specific requirements, is growing steadily worldwide. Likewise, software-based real-time management of personal protective equipment (PPE), tools and other assets is the future and is increasingly demanded and further developed both within our group of companies and on the market. The service portfolio therefore fits perfectly into our sales and business development strategy and Heinemann Projektberatung is the perfect partner for this with many years of experience and an impressive track record,” says Caspar Spreter, Managing Director of WINDEA Offshore.

Heinemann Projektberatung was founded in Wilhelmshaven in 2011 and has since then been managed by Holger Heinemann as owner and managing director. The main training center is located in Elsfleth, near Bremen. A large number of the trainings can also be conducted directly at the customer’s site, onsite or as interactive online training. Under the brand “windskills”, the range of services focus on industrial training for the onshore and offshore wind industry, in particular safety training in accordance with GWO standards, corresponding training in accordance with national requirements (BG/DGUV), and technical training for the entire system cycle. Standardized Helicopter Underwater Escape Training (HUET) as well as specific training, for example for the flight crew (HEMS), complete the portfolio. The possibility of adapting training courses to the real protection, safety and rescue concepts of the respective customer should be emphasized, in order to establish safe procedures and to continuously develop these further in partnership.

Holger Heinemann, Managing Director of Heinemann Projektberatung, gives an outlook: “WINDEA Offshore’s sales strength, market access and product development capabilities will give us new impulses to further develop our business. With WINDEA as our partner, we intend to accelerate the development of training locations, expand our customer base and continuously expand our young business field of materials management through professional product development.”

In autumn 2017, Heinemann Projektberatung expanded its portfolio to include the software-based real-time materials management, offering storage, inspection, maintenance, commissioning, and tracking of equipment (e.g., PPE) as well as tools and other materials for customers in the wind industry. Since then, this business area has been further developed due to the steadily growing demand in the market and is to be transferred to other industries. This is because customers usually lack the necessary human and time resources to set up a flawless management of such assets. The full-service approach specially developed by Heinemann Projektberatung enables customers to have mobile digital access to transparent and valid real-time data regarding the history, status, and affiliation of the materials.
